A delegation from the Cambodian Royal Army led by General Dieng Sarun, Deputy Chief of Staff of High Command of Guards, paid a Tet visit to the Mekong Delta province of Soc Trang on February 11.

At the reception, Secretary of the provincial Party Committee Vo Minh Chien expressed his wish that the friendship and solidarity between the two nations be further consolidated in the future.

The living conditions of Soc Trang people, especially Khmer ethnic people, have much improved, he added.

He said he hoped that Cambodian army officials, especially the General, will make more contributions to tightening the friendship between the two countries.

For his part, General Dieng Sarun said he was pleased with positive changes in the life of Soc Trang people, particularly the poor and the minority.

He thanked the Vietnam People’s Army in general and the Soc Trang people in particular for their help for Cambodia in the struggle against the Khmer Rouge regime in the past as well as in the current national construction.

On the occasion of Tet, the General wished the Soc Trang authorities and people a happy and prosperous new year./.
